Santa will make four separate appearances this holiday season during Paws & Claus: Holiday Portraits with Santa.

Bring up to four pets, and not inky cats and dogs. If you’ve got a ferret, bunny, parakeet or other well-behaved, easy-to-manage creature, bring ‘em on! Pose with them or let them soak up the spotlight all themselves.

For a suggested $25 donation, you’ll get a digital image to share online or make into 10,000 prints to hand out to strangers to prove that yours are truly the most adorable creatures to have ever pooped on your sofa.
